## Capacity note: Harrowfield telemetry gateway

Each gateway node handles tractor and combine telemetry for roughly one regional depot. During harvest season, message rates triple, so support should expect queue-depth alerts in late summer and not escalate unless sustained beyond an hour. Adding a node requires updating the shard map first. Current per-node capacity limits are defined by these constants.

tuning constants:
PRIORITIES = {
    "novath": 389,
    "kelix": 751,
}

Subject: Tax-rate cache cut-over complete

Team, the Lumenrate tax-rate lookup cache went live Tuesday at 02:00. We verified hit ratios above 97% across the Calvero and Brinth regions, and fallback to the authoritative service behaved correctly during the forced-miss test. No rate discrepancies observed. The cache now runs with the following configuration values.

settings of tagef-bawif:
DRUIX_HOST=druix.zemvarlabs.internal
DRUIX_PORT=8000

Ticket: The trace-collector credential for the Spanvine request-tracing pipeline expired over the weekend, which is why spans from the checkout and inventory microservices stopped stitching together in Glasstrail. Symptom: orphaned root spans and missing downstream hops; no data was lost, only correlation. Future maintainers: this key expires every 90 days and there is no automated renewal yet — please add a calendar reminder or wire it into the rotation job. A fresh credential has been issued, recorded below for the pipeline config.

API key for kafop-fafof: qvz3-4pw